Robinson & Hall property auctions
A regional property consultancy established in 1882 with offices in Bedford and Buckingham, holding bi-monthly auctions at the Delta Marriott Hotel, Milton Keynes. It sells residential, commercial and agricultural property and land; its auction department now operates in partnership with Auction House UK. How auction finance works for Robinson & Hall lots
At a Robinson & Hall auction, the hammer is an exchange of contracts: you pay a deposit on the day and complete inside the catalogue deadline, often 28 days but sometimes shorter. A standard mortgage may not fit that timetable, which is why bidders consider auction finance or a bridging loan.
